This event has been set to help Sagina nivalis (Rob) celebrate finding all the surviving Welsh trigpoints. On the morning of Sunday 10th August 2008 he will climb Colva Hill to bag the trigpoint there and then head off to The Hundred House Inn for lunch. In the afternoon, he will climb Red Hill to bag his last Welsh trigpoint. Each hill is approximately a 5km trip. You are invited to join in for all or part of the day, either the morning or afternoon climb or both, or simply for lunch at the pub. 

The Hundred House Inn will be serving Sunday roast: choice of beef, lamb or pork (vegetarian option available) with fresh vegetables at a cost of £6.50 per head (£4.00 for children). Puddings will also be available. There are two cask ales available at the bar, Brains and Reverend James. Pre-booking for lunch is pretty much essential - they will continue serving food until it runs out. Lunch starts at 12 noon, with the morning climbers aiming to be there by 1pm.

We will have the usual travel bug and geocoin swapping at the pub. To log the event you can either take part in one of the climbs or pop along to the pub. Rob will be inviting some non-caching, trigpointing friends - we shall have to introduce them to geocaching.
